性能评测 香港vps 原生ip 与虚拟共享IP的速度对比

2026-04-12 21:52:55
当前位置: 博客 > 香港服务器

本篇目标是用可复现的步骤对比“香港VPS使用原生IP(Public IP/独立公网IP)”与“使用虚拟共享IP(NAT/共享公网IP)”在真实网络条件下的速度差异。总体思路是:在相同VPS规格与相同软件配置下,分别对两类IP做多维度测试(带宽、延迟、丢包、并发HTTP下载),多次测量取统计数据并比对。

步骤:1) 选两台规格相同的香港VPS实例(CPU、内存、磁盘、机房位置、网络计费模式一致)。2) 一台必须分配原生公网IP;另一台如果无法直接获得“共享IP”,可向供应商申请NAT/共享公网IP或使用其提供的“虚拟IP”产品。3) 统一系统(建议Ubuntu 20.04/22.04)并关闭多余服务。

确认方法:登录VPS控制面板查看IP类型标注;在系统内使用命令查看公网IP(curl -s https://ipinfo.io/ip)。若供应商说明是“NAT/共享IP”或IP池则为共享IP。若能购买“独立公网IP/弹性IP”则为原生IP。

香港原生IP

操作步骤:1) 更新系统 sudo apt update && sudo apt upgrade -y。2) 统一网络配置:关闭不必要的防火墙(sudo ufw disable)或在两台上开放相同端口测试。3) 统一MTU(检查 ip link show;修改 sudo ip link set dev eth0 mtu 1500)。4) 禁用IPv6测试时的一致性(sudo sysctl -w net.ipv6.conf.all.disable_ipv6=1)。

必装:iperf3(带宽与延迟),mtr/traceroute(路由与丢包分析),ping(延迟),curl/wget(下载速率),wrk或ab(并发HTTP压力)。安装命令示例:sudo apt install -y iperf3 mtr traceroute curl wget apache2-utils build-essential libssl-dev && sudo apt install -y wrk(若仓库无wrk可从源码编译)。

步骤详解:1) 在测试服务器端运行 iperf3 -s。2) 在客户端(外部测试点或另一台VPS)运行 iperf3 -c <测试目标IP> -t 60 -P 4(-t 时间,-P 并发流)。3) 建议分别运行 TCP 与 UDP:UDP 使用 -u 和 -b 指定带宽限制(例如 -u -b 100M)。4) 每种配置跑至少5次,记录平均值与最大/最小。

步骤:1) 在目标VPS部署简单HTTP服务(sudo apt install -y nginx; 放置一个静态1GB文件在/var/www/html/largefile.bin)。2) 使用wrk做并发请求:wrk -t2 -c100 -d30 http:///largefile.bin(-t 线程,-c 并发连接)。3) 用curl或wget下载测实际下载速率:wget -O /dev/null http:///largefile.bin 并记录平均速度。4) 多次测试并在不同时间段重复。

步骤:1) 基本延迟:ping -c 100 ,记录平均(avg)、最小(min)、最大(max)。2) 路由与丢包:mtr -r -c 100 ,关注丢包列与每跳延迟。3) 分析是否在本地到HK链路或供应商边缘出现丢包,注意共享IP常见的NAT/边缘过载会增加丢包。

细则:1) 同一时间段不要同时在两台VPS上跑大流量以免互相干扰。2) 在低峰与高峰时段各跑一次(例如UTC 02:00 与 12:00)。3) 每项测试至少5次取中位数;保留原始输出日志(重定向到文件)。4) 若可能,从第三方节点(例如家用宽带、国外VPS)分别对两IP做拉取测试以模拟真实用户体验。

记录方式:建立CSV列:时间、测试类型、IP类型、带宽峰值、平均延迟、丢包率、并发请求成功数、备注。分析:比较平均带宽(Mbps)、延迟(ms)与丢包率;关注p95/p99延迟与并发时的成功率。若共享IP在并发下载或UDP下表现明显差于原生IP,则说明NAT或共享带宽限制影响较大。

建议:1) 若发现MTU问题可调整MTU至更低(例如1460)测试是否改善丢包。2) 检查TCP窗口与拥塞(sysctl net.core.rmem_max等)。3) 与供应商确认NAT设备是否做了连接限制或端口复用。4) 若频繁丢包或高延迟且业务敏感,优先选择原生公网IP或更好的带宽保证方案。

示例命令:sudo apt update && sudo apt install -y iperf3 mtr wrk curl wget
在服务器:iperf3 -s > /root/iperf_server.log 2>&1 &
客户端TCP:iperf3 -c -t 60 -P 4 > iperf_tcp_client.log
客户端UDP:iperf3 -c -u -b 100M -t 30 > iperf_udp_client.log
并发HTTP:wrk -t2 -c100 -d30 http:///largefile.bin > wrk.log

结论方向:通常情况下,原生IP在延迟、丢包与并发吞吐上优于共享IP,尤其是高并发与UDP应用。但共享IP成本低、部署快,适合非实时或低流量业务。最终选择应基于测试数据、业务需求和预算权衡。

Q1: 原生IP和虚拟共享IP在延迟和带宽上一般差别有多大?

A1: 视供应商与网络拥堵而定,但常见情况是原生IP在高并发或UDP场景下延迟更低、丢包率更小,带宽更稳定;共享IP在峰值时间可能出现速率下降或连接被限速。通过上文的iperf3与wrk多次测试能量化差距(例如平均差距可从几Mbps到几十Mbps不等)。

Q2: 做测试时如何保证数据可靠、不被NAT或防火墙影响?

A2: 保证双方配置一致:关闭或统一防火墙规则、设置相同MTU、禁用IPv6、在同一时间段内多次测试,并从多个不同来源(第三方节点)验测以确认是否为NAT/边缘设备导致的问题。此外保留完整日志便于与供应商沟通。

Q3: 购买香港VPS时如何确认获得的是原生公网IP?

A3: 在购买前询问供应商是否提供“独立公网IP/弹性IP/原生IP”,查看控制面板是否注明“Public IP/独立IP”。购买后可以通过 curl -s https://ipinfo.io/json 查看IP及提供商信息,若供应商说明IP属于“共享/CGNAT/私有池”则不是原生公网IP。

相关文章
  • 使用香港原生IP机场提升网络速度的技巧

    在现代社会,互联网速度的快慢直接影响到我们的工作和生活。尤其是在需要稳定连接的场合,选择合适的网络工具显得尤为重要。通过使用香港原生IP的机场服务,可以有效提升网络速度,实现更流畅的上网体验。本文
  • 选择香港高防服务器的五大理由让你不再犹豫

    在当今网络安全形势日益严峻的环境下,选择一款合适的服务器显得尤为重要。香港高防服务器因其独特的地理位置和强大的防护能力,受到了越来越多企业的青睐。本文将为你详细解析选择香港高防服务器的五
  • 了解香港原生IP的真正含义与价值

    在当今互联网时代,IP地址是网络通信中不可或缺的一部分。尤其是香港原生IP,作为一种特殊类型的IP地址,在许多技术应用中扮演着重要角色。本文将深入探讨香港原生IP的真正含义与价值,帮助您更好